Receiving emails from unknown or anonymous senders can be frustrating and worrisome. You might want to validate their true identity for security reasons or simply out of interest. Fortunately, there's a tool that can help: reverse email lookup. This technique allows you to reveal the information associated with an email address, shedding light on the sender behind the cryptic alias.

Reverse email lookup services work by scanning massive databases of public records and online profiles. When you input an email address, these services examine the provided information and provide relevant results. These results can include the sender's full name, physical address, social media profiles, and even past email addresses associated with the same individual.

  • Using reverse email lookup can be particularly useful in situations where you receive spam emails, phishing attempts, or messages from unknown individuals who may pose a threat. It can also assist you in confirming the identity of someone you're interacting with online.

Remember that not all reverse email lookup services are created equal. Some may offer more accurate and comprehensive results than others. It's important to select a reputable service with a proven track record and positive user reviews.

Unlocking Public Records for Genealogy: A Step-by-Step Guide

Embarking on a genealogy journey can be thrilling, and accessing public records is often the key to unveiling your family's past. These invaluable documents, ranging copyright, marriage licenses, and death records, can reveal light on your ancestors' lives.

To begin your search, pinpoint the specific files you need based on your genealogical goals. Next, determine the area where your ancestors lived. Many jurisdictions offer online databases of public records, which can be a streamlined starting point.

  • Investigate government platforms, such as the National Archives and Records Administration (NARA) for federal records.
  • Leverage genealogy websites that specialize in public record searches, which often provide access to a vast collection of digitized documents.
  • Contact local courthouses, offices and historical societies to inquire about access for accessing physical records.

Remember that certain public records may require a fee or formal request process. Maintain meticulous documentation throughout your search, including the dates and locations of your inquiries, as well as any information you gather.
